Currently I am residing in USA on H4 visa. I am applying for my H1b petition on April 1st 2013. I have to travel to India in the month of April 2013 and will return back in May 2013. Following are my questions regarding this.

1) Will there be any problem to my status if I travel out of US while my H1B application is under process with USCIS?

2) Given the situation, what option would be the best to be selected in i129 form when applying for H1b petition CONSULAR PROCESS or CHANGE OF STATUS PROCESS.

3) Are there any options that would be safe for me to travel to India and get my H1B petition approved as well.

Approval of H1B is NEVER guaranteed, but your travel will not in itself affect the approval or rejection. If you do not have a new I-94 for Oct1 start date in your hand before you leave, you will need stamping or COS filed after you return.

Inform your prospective employer of your plans. His attorney will complete the paperwork in the most advantageous manner. For example, he may choose PP to have decision before you leave.
